If you plan to do a lot of ZIP file creation from Python, it's usually a whole lot faster, and may produce smaller files, if you call out to an external utility to do the compression instead of doing it from within the Python zipfile module. You can also pass compression arguments like -9 that produce smaller files. A while back I wrote a wrapper around zipfile that can call out to the external program if available, otherwise it falls back on using internal zipfile.
